Failure Analysis of Ribbon Spring Used in Aviation Clutch of a Turbo Starter

XIAOMING ZONG, FEI GAO

Abstract


The present work details a study performed for determination of the causes of the premature rupture of a spring used in aviation clutch of a turbo starter. The study is based on the general methodology applicable to failure analysis. Fracture surface, mechanical and chemical properties and microstructure of the spring material are analyzed. The results showed that the fracture of the spring was caused by a mechanical fatigue mechanism. The cracks and fracture initiate on the inner surface, and the opening direction of cracks is consistent with the residual tensile stress of the spring inner surface. The fracture of the spring was caused by a mechanical fatigue mechanism whose origin is related to stress concentrations, probably aggravated by oxide inclusions.
